The movie received mixed reviews from critics but was a commercial success, grossing over $200 million worldwide. The film's CGI animation and Bill Murray's voice acting were widely praised. The movie's success can be attributed to its lighthearted humor, which appeals to both children and adults.

The beloved comic strip character, Garfield, has been entertaining audiences for decades with his sarcastic wit and love for lasagna. In 2004, a live-action/CGI movie featuring Garfield was released, starring Bill Murray as the voice of the titular character. The Hives are back, and this time they're doing it in white jackets. The Swedish five-some hit the American music scene hard three years ago, when, according to their website, the album Veni Vidi Vicious "reintroduced rock in the mainstream (No, I mean actual ROCK MUSIC)."
